How does ACX handle royalty payments for narrators and rights holders?

ACX has faced criticism for its handling of royalty payments, with reports of delayed payments and a policy where earnings under $10 in a month are held until they total $50. Additionally, there have been complaints about ACX retaining earnings if the threshold is not met, which has caused frustration among narrators and rights holders.

What challenges do authors face with ACXs policies on returns and royalties?

Authors have expressed frustration over ACXs policy on returns, where listeners can return audiobooks even after consumption, resulting in a deduction of royalties from rights holders. Additionally, authors have raised concerns about ACXs royalty rates being inadequate, especially when combined with policies that allow earnings to be withheld based on certain thresholds.

How does ACXs approval process for audiobook projects impact users?

Users have noted that ACXs approval process for audiobook projects can be time-consuming, with projects often taking longer to be approved compared to other platforms. Some users have also highlighted challenges with ACXs policy that requires titles to be on sale through Amazon, which can affect marketing strategies and timelines for audiobook releases.
